What Are Stative Verbs?
Stative verbs (also called state verbs) describe a condition, situation, or state of being—not an action. They often refer to:
- Thoughts and opinions (e.g., know, believe, understand)
- Emotions (e.g., love, hate, prefer)
- Possession (e.g., have, own, belong)
- Senses (e.g., smell, hear, taste when describing the state)
- Appearance or existence (e.g., seem, appear, be)
Examples:
- ✅ I know the answer.
❌ I am knowing the answer. - ✅ She loves chocolate.
❌ She is loving chocolate. (Unless in marketing: “I’m loving it!”) - ✅ This book belongs to me.
❌ This book is belonging to me.
Important Rule:
Stative verbs are not usually used in the continuous (–ing) form, because they describe something that just is, rather than something that is happening.
